CHARLESTON, S.C. (WCSC) – A man is facing charges after Charleston Police say he hit another man in the face with a handgun.
Austin Oneil Chrisley, 37, was charged with assault and battery of a high and aggravated nature and possession of a weapon during a violent crime, jail records show.
A police report states the victim went to a party on Beaufain Street around 3 a.m. on Feb. 26 to meet some friends.
Upon the victim’s arrival, Chrisley called him a “rat b—-” and a “snitch” before walking around the kitchen counter and hitting him in the mouth with a gun, the report states.
When the victim ran out of the apartment he saw the gun Chrisley was holding. Chrisley then pointed the gun at the victim and threatened to kill him, the report states.
